Alabama Statutes
§ 22-29-14 — Bonds and Coupons Deemed Negotiable Instruments
Alabama·Title 22 Health, Mental Health, and Environmental Control·Ch. 29 Pollution Control Finance Authority
All bonds issued by the authority, while not registered, shall be construed to be negotiable instruments even though they are payable from a limited source. All coupons applicable to any bonds issued by the authority, while the applicable bonds are not registered as to both principal and interest, shall likewise be construed to be negotiable instruments although payable from a limited source.
